US honours Sept 11 victims 15 years after attacks

Published Sun, Sep 11, 2016 · 09:50 PM

    New York

    AMERICANS commemorated the 15th anniversary of the Sept 11, 2001, attacks on Sunday with the recital of the names of the dead, tolling church bells and a tribute in lights at the site where New York City's massive twin towers collapsed.

    The names of the 2,983 victims were read slowly by relatives as classical music played during a ceremony at the 9/11 Memorial plaza in lower Manhattan with pauses for six moments of silence.
